ILLINOIS STATE POLICE ANNOUNCE OFFICIAL MISCONDUCT ARREST

Benton, Il- Illinois State Police officials announce the arrest of Chet L. Shaffer, a fifty-eight (58) year old male of rural Thompsonville, Illinois, who was arrested on three counts of Official Misconduct, two counts of Custodial Sexual Misconduct and two counts of Aggravated Criminal Sexual Assault. 

 On Friday, August 15, 2019, the Franklin County Sheriff’s Office received information regarding allegations of sexual assault against Shaffer, who is a Franklin County Sheriff’s Office jail employee; Shaffer was immediately placed on administrative leave. The Franklin County Sheriff’s Office requested the Illinois State Police investigate the allegations.  The investigation resulted in charges against Shaffer and his arrest on August 22, 2019.  Shaffer was able to post 10% of the $100,000.00 bond, and was released.

 The Illinois State Police, in conjunction with Franklin County Sheriff’s Office and the Appellate Prosecutor’s Office, continues to investigate.  Anyone with additional information is encouraged to contact Illinois State Police- Zone 7 Investigations at (618) 542-2171.   No additional information will be provided at this time.

2020 Election Cycle Begins Soon

The November 2020 election is still more than 15 months away, but the candidacy process begins soon. Wabash County Clerk Janet Will reports that candidate packets will be available for pickup on September 3rd. That’s the same date petitions can begin to be circulated. The filing period for the March 17th primary is November 25th though December 2nd. Locally offices up for election include coroner, state’s attorney, circuit clerk, and the 6 year county commissioner seat presently held by Robie Thompson.

District #348 School Board Ratifies 4 Year Contract With WCTA

The Wabash District #348 school board has ratified a new four year contract with the Wabash County Teacher’s Association. The new deal was approved Monday night by the school board and August 12th by the teachers. The pact calls for a 1 ½% salary increase the first year, 1% the second and third years, and a half percent the final year. Insurance coverage and rates remain the same. School Board President Tim Schuler commended negotiators on both sides for their work in hammering out the new contract.

That new teacher’s contract has had a ripple down effect on the proposed 2019-2020 budget in District #348. Superintendent Dr. Chuck Bleyer said the proposed budget he had ready to present to the school board Monday night would need to be adjusted to reflect the salary schedule for teachers. A revised proposed budget will be presented to the school board next month, according to Bleyer.
